Treo Eile and Irish Polocrosse Association Announce 2025 Thoroughbred Sponsorship Partnership
Treo Eile is delighted to continue its collaboration with the Irish Polocrosse Association for the 2025 season, supporting the inclusion and recognition of retired racehorses in the fast-paced, team-oriented sport of polocrosse.
Polocrosse has emerged as a dynamic second-career pathway for thoroughbreds, where their speed, agility, and responsiveness are valuable assets on the field. This year’s sponsorship programme will see Treo Eile provide dedicated support and prizes at five club tournaments, two international team events, and the Irish National Championships.
The initiative reflects Treo Eile’s mission to promote thoroughbred retraining and to provide tangible reward structures across a range of equestrian disciplines. Horses will be clearly marked with Treo Eile hip stickers at each competition, and all eligible horses must be registered with Treo Eile and have a Weatherbys (or equivalent) passport.

2025 National Championships
The Irish Polocrosse Association National Championships take place on August 30–31, hosted by Equus Club at Bishopsland Polo Club, Kildare.
This flagship event will see the Best Playing Thoroughbred in Categories A, B, C, and D each awarded a comprehensive prize pack including a Treo Eile rug, gilet, baseball cap, and rosette.
This event serves as a national platform to showcase the quality and progress of retrained racehorses and underlines the growing impact of thoroughbreds in the polocrosse community.
